ETF filings for event contract portfolios

James Seyffart highlights the arrival of ETF filings designed for portfolios that function like actively managed event contracts, commonly known as prediction markets.

He adds that some of these offerings would allow betting on sports events. Seyffart states that while approval is unlikely in the near term, these products will remain pending in anticipation of potential regulatory changes by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ission.

Seyffart has previously tracked ETF activity in different segments of the market. He noted that holders of the Ethereum ETF have seen losses, with the average cost basis near $3,400 while the token trades at $1,700, according to his earlier analysis. Seyffart also pointed out the launch of SPCL, a 2X leveraged ETF tied to SpaceX, now trading on U.S. markets, in a separate report.
